Dental implants are small titanium posts that replace the root of a missing tooth and are bonded to the jaw to secure a replacement tooth. Implants can be used to replace one or many missing teeth or to make a denture more stable. They are a permanent solution and they look and feel like natural teeth.

When would I need dental implants?
There are a few reasons why you might need dental implants:
- You have missing or severely broken teeth
- You’re looking for a more permanent solution to removable dentures
- A severe gum infection (known as periodontitis) has caused the need for one or more teeth to be removed.
Despite your reason for needing dental implants, replacing missing teeth quickly can help restore good oral health. And help you reclaim an aesthetically pleasing smile and ru+-e any risk of future dental problems.
Before you commit to dental implants, there are factors you should consider about whether you are a candidate for dental implants or you should consider an alternative missing tooth replacement.
- You have missing teeth. Having missing teeth is the most obvious sign you are a candidate for implants. It is important to note that their are other options for missing teeth including bridges and dentures, but if you have tried those in the past or are searching for a more permanent solution, then its worth inquiring about implants
- Your gums and teeth are in good health. If your teeth and gums are in bad condition, this can cause a high risk of implant failure.
- You have adequate bone structure to support the implant
- You have a good oral hygiene regimen. Oral hygiene and routine professional maintenance is necessary for long term durability of dental implants
All things considered, if you’re well, have healthy gums and strong jawbones, it’s likely that you’re a good candidate for dental implants.
